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9366618 5474264 92383014156 451213244 63
61176487966 4665254500
61176487966 4665254500
22537 376836 34
All about undefined
Interested in learning more?
61176487966 4665254500
22537 376836 34
See more
14 7532159 635641
5456 45689377305 6744 34870692
See more
956 68095487166 71232854
0909328 579 17354077
See more